However, it has been argued that this evolutionary perspective lacks validity.
-Schank (2004) suggests that if too many females had synchronised cycles it would increase the competition for highest quality males and potentially lower the fitness of any offspring. This suggests that avoidance of synchronicity would be the most adaptive strategy.

A strength of the sleep cycle is that studies have found REM to be highly correlated with dreaming
-Dement and Kleitman monitored the brain waves on nine adult participants in a sleep lab. Brain wave activity was recorded on an EEG and the researchers controlled the effects of caffeine, and alcohol.
-brain activity varied depending how vivid the dreams were, and when participants were woken during dreaming, they were able to report their dreams more clearly.
